Memorandum dated July 28, 1950, from Mr. Carpenter, Secretary Of the Board, recommending the appointment of Mrs. Jean F. Stockwell aS a file clerk in the Office of the Secretary on a temporary basis for a period of six months, with basic salary at the rate of $2,730 per annum, effective as of the date upon which she enters upon the Performance of her duties after having passed the usual physical examination. Approved unanimously. Telegram to Mr. Rounds, First Vice President of the Federal Reserve Bank of New York, reading as follows: 1037 7/31/50 -2- "Re your letter July.28 concerning proposed election of Mr. Ira Guilden as a trustee of Title Guarantee and Trust Company (a nonmember trust company) while continuing to serve as chairman and director of Trade Bank and Trust Company (a member bank) in view of provisions of section 8 of the Clayton Act and Board's Regulation L. On the basis of the facts stated in your letter, Board concurs in the views expressed in the last paragraph of your letter that such service would be permitted." Approved unanimously.
